  • How do oysters get rid of waste?

    As oysters digest food, waste collects in a cavity inside their shell. ... Every once in a while, the oyster claps its shell together and pushes out most of the water out of its body, along with any waste. While oysters do expel feces and pseudofaeces, they ultimately leave water cleaner.

  • Why are crayfish bad for the environment?

    The size, aggression and large appetites of rusty crayfish make them a threat to native species, as they compete successfully for food and shelter. They may reduce fish and invertebrate populations by eating their eggs, larvae or adult forms.

  • How do you farm crawfish at home?

    Use a 1-by-2-foot-long tank for each pair. Put a layer of gravel on the bottom. Arrange rocks, tiles, flowerpots or decorative objects to create nooks and crannies for hiding places. Aerate the water with a fish-tank bubbler, as crayfish breathe through gills.

  • What makes a fish a teleost?

    Teleosts are characterized by a fully movable maxilla and premaxilla (which form the biting surface of the upper jaw); the movable upper jaw makes it possible for teleosts to protrude their jaws when opening the mouth. Teleosts are also distinguished by having fully homocercal (symmetrical) tails.

  • What kind of water do herring live in?

    Herring are forage fish, mostly belonging to the family Clupeidae. Herring often move in large schools around fishing banks and near the coast, found particularly in shallow, temperate waters of the North Pacific and North Atlantic Oceans, including the Baltic Sea, as well as off the west coast of South America.
